The Evolution of Red Carpet Fashion: A Historical Perspective on Glamour
Red carpet fashion has undergone a remarkable transformation since its inception in the early 20th century. Initially, the red carpet served as a literal pathway for dignitaries and celebrities, with little emphasis on fashion. However, as Hollywood emerged as a cultural powerhouse in the 1920s, the red carpet became a stage for showcasing opulent gowns and tailored suits. The 1950s and 60s saw icons like Audrey Hepburn and Grace Kelly redefine elegance, while the 1980s introduced bold colors and extravagant designs, reflecting the era’s excess. Today, red carpet fashion encompasses a diverse range of styles, from haute couture to avant-garde, with celebrities using their platform to challenge traditional notions of beauty and gender norms.
Breaking Down the Most Shocking Trends of the Past Decade in Red Carpet Attire
The past decade has witnessed a slew of shocking trends that have redefined red carpet fashion. One of the most notable shifts has been the rise of gender-fluid fashion, with stars like Billy Porter and Janelle Monáe donning outfits that blur the lines between traditional masculinity and femininity. Additionally, the trend of sheer fabrics and daring cutouts has pushed the boundaries of what is considered acceptable, with celebrities opting for looks that reveal more than they conceal. The use of unconventional materials, such as plastic and metallics, has also gained traction, challenging the norms of fabric choice and construction. These bold choices not only captivate audiences but also spark conversations about body positivity and self-expression.
The Role of Celebrity Influence in Shaping Contemporary Fashion Trends
Celebrities have always played a pivotal role in shaping fashion trends, and their influence has only intensified in the age of social media. Designers often seek to dress high-profile figures for red carpet events, knowing that their choices can lead to a significant increase in sales and visibility. The phenomenon of “red carpet moments” has become a marketing strategy for both celebrities and designers, with many stars collaborating closely with fashion houses to create bespoke looks. Furthermore, the rise of influencers and fashion-forward celebrities has democratized fashion, allowing for a broader range of styles to gain traction. As a result, what was once reserved for the elite is now accessible to the masses, with fans eager to emulate their favorite stars.
Sustainable Fashion: How Eco-Conscious Choices Are Transforming the Red Carpet
In recent years, the fashion industry has faced increasing scrutiny over its environmental impact, prompting a shift towards sustainable practices. The red carpet has become a platform for eco-conscious choices, with many celebrities opting for sustainable designers or vintage pieces to make a statement about their commitment to the environment. Events like the Met Gala have seen a surge in sustainable fashion, with stars showcasing outfits made from recycled materials or ethically sourced fabrics. This trend not only highlights the importance of sustainability in fashion but also encourages fans to consider their own consumption habits. As the conversation around climate change continues to grow, it is likely that sustainable fashion will remain a significant focus on the red carpet.
The Impact of Social Media on Red Carpet Fashion Trends and Celebrity Choices
Social media has revolutionized the way fashion is consumed and perceived, particularly in the context of red carpet events. Platforms like Instagram and Twitter allow fans to engage with their favorite celebrities in real-time, creating a dialogue around fashion choices and trends. The immediacy of social media means that red carpet looks can go viral within minutes, influencing public perception and setting trends almost instantaneously. Additionally, social media has given rise to a new breed of fashion critics and influencers, who analyze and comment on red carpet attire, further shaping the narrative around what is deemed fashionable. This dynamic interaction between celebrities and their audience has transformed the red carpet into a more inclusive and participatory space.
